CALI has made a submission to Treasury’s review of the amended Unfair Contract Terms (UCT) protections. The submission draws on industry experience since the extension of the UCT regime to life insurance and focuses on areas where greater clarity would support effective consumer protections while maintaining certainty for long‑term insurance contracts.
Our submission highlights practical considerations relevant to long term life insurance contracts, including the operation of remedies and penalties and the application of the regime to group insurance arrangements. CALI’s comments are intended to assist Treasury in assessing whether the framework is operating as intended and where targeted clarification may be beneficial.
